Transaction 58d026f05f72f92ae610436247be64e5e72734858b907f4e062ed6e4e77067a8
1 Input
2 Outputs
- 58d026f05f72f92ae610436247be64e5e72734858b907f4e062ed6e4e77067a8:0
- 58d026f05f72f92ae610436247be64e5e72734858b907f4e062ed6e4e77067a8:1
value 810159
address 32UYsowvZVrnS7Af2HoEEvZdBSE5DmsPse
value 21018973
address 14ryApTjfw3eivemz1jADR32ktRGmwJMAW